The "Asset Champion Podcast" offers candid conversations with some of the industry's most successful asset management leaders. In each 20-minute episode, host Mike Petrusky talks with guests about emerging trends in asset management for fleet, construction, manufacturing, and facilities. You'll discover best practices that will help you streamline your preventive maintenance, work orders, inventory, inspections, and more. You'll also get to know each guest on a more personal level and hear their unique perspectives on today's major shift toward data-enabled operations. Ep. 21: Enterprise Asset Management and Maintenance Strategies for Research Facilities with Kylash Ramesh of The National Institutes of Health
Kylash Ramesh is a Management Analyst in the Office of Research Facilities (ORF) and Division of Facilities Operations & Maintenance (DFOM) at The National Institutes of Health in Bethesda, Maryland. He is a Program Manager for ORF Asset Management which includes the internal policy, contractual language, and procedure applicable to all NIH construction/renovation projects, facilitating the turnover of data between the contractor and owner (NIH) and is responsible for the inventory of all facility assets on the Bethesda campus. Mike Petrusky asks Kylash about his facility management journey and they discuss how asset management strategies are essential to the success of our federal government's critical infrastructure while offering inspiration for Asset Champions!
